The first session of the Constituent Assembly was held in
Bombay
Lahore
Calcutta
New Delhi
- Option 1: Bombay
- Bombay, now Mumbai, was an important city during the colonial era.
- However, it was not the location for the first session of the Constituent Assembly.
- Option 2: Lahore
- Lahore was a cultural and political hub during British India, now in Pakistan.
- It did not host the first session of the Constituent Assembly.
- Option 3: Calcutta
- Known as Kolkata today, Calcutta was another key city in British India.
- It was not chosen for the Constituent Assembly's first session.
- Option 4: New Delhi
- New Delhi is the correct answer.
- It was the venue for the first session of the Constituent Assembly in December 1946.
